The Myth of Job “Jail”

Are you feeling stuck in a job right now, and telling yourself it has something to do with your age? Feeling like you’ve just got to stick it out at this point?

I was there too. With voices in my head that, I bet, sound a lot like yours.

It’s too late to make a career move now.

I know my way around this job. It’s just easier to stay.

Do I really have much to offer?

I’ve got seniority vacation time. No place else will give me that.

No one is looking for people my age.

I need to just be steady and responsible, get through it until retirement.

Now I’m going to say something else you’ve heard before : LIFE IS SHORT

It is too short for an OKAY experience, too short to enjoy yourself LATER, and too short for GOOD ENOUGH.

YES. The thought of trying to do something different brings up anxiety, and doubt and sounds like too much work. But what is the WORK you are putting in now? There IS a sacrifice either way. You might not think about it that way now, but 20 years forward – how will you look back at this decision?

Why don’t we trust ourselves to just MAKE things work out? That we can come out on the positive side of a big change? Instead, we find a zillion excuses of why something isn’t possible. We do it because there is SAFETY there - where we can believe that what happens in our life is about random circumstance. When it is truly ALL up to us

There are ALWAYS options. Usually, not one that is perfect (kind of like your current circumstance) but there ARE options. Accept that there is a downside to any choice. Pick the one that offers you the most, and don’t look back.

You don’t need to resign tomorrow. MAKE A PLAN. Decide what it is you would really like to do and start investigating what it would take. How could you make it work? Maybe it is something more inside of, or in addition to, the job you have. Something more that you should have the courage to ask for.

Just REFUSE to give in to the critic in your head and to accept what is. Stick with it, keep searching, until you make it happen.

Because it MATTERS and you are WORTH the effort.
